Strength of schedule is calculated from the opponents projected fantasy points allowed for the WR position. The best rating is +16 which gives the player the advantage against the defense and indicates an easy opponent, the worst rating is -16 which gives the defense the advantage and indicates a tough opponent.

Round 8, Pick 4
Positives Very productive, with a career average of 70-1050-8 over 16 games. The clear #1 WR on a rapidly improving team. The need to defend Gore should allow him to work in space. Lethal in the red zone. Negatives Creaky knees. Has missed ~40% of potential starts in the last two seasons. Alex Smith needs to develop to make Jackson a real fantasy threat. Draft Strategy There's a real argument to going QB here, with Hasselbeck and EManning available. However, Jackson is around far too late here -- he's a solid WR2 whose ADP is around a round higher than this. I will take my chances at QB, looking to play the matchups with a couple serviceable guys. (Contributed by: Agenda42)
